Ginger Steak
Added fresh grated ginger and maybe an extra teaspoon of lemon juice. I browned both sides of a 1-lb slab of rib eye with some chopped garlic and then put it into the oven to broil for about 5-10 minutes. I took out the meat and let it rest for another 5-10 minutes, letting the juices seep in and allowing the meat to cook a little more. It turned out a perfect medium rare. The marinade as-is is a little salty, but good since I didn't soak the meat in the marinade for any significant amount of time prior to broiling. Many rave responses (which was great!)
